Playoff Bound: Fannin Travels To North Cobb Christian Thursday For First Round Of Playoffs

The Fannin County Rebels secured their spot in the GHSA AA State Baseball Playoffs for the third year in a row. Thanks to a fourth-place Region 7AA finish, the Rebels will travel to North Cobb Christian on Thursday to take on the #1-seeded Eagles.

Fannin’s April 19th victory over Haralson County propelled them to an 8-10 Region record, giving them the final playoff spot in the Region over 7-11 North Murray.

Fannin vs Haralson County game three recap:

The scoreboard was lit up early in this Region 7AA contest, as both the Haralson Rebels and Fannin Rebels scored in the first inning. Paul Stroemer gave Fannin a 3-1 lead with a three-RBI double in the bottom of the first, and Fannin would hold that lead the entirety of the ballgame as they took a 4-1 victory over Haralson County.

Mason McDaniel earned the W on the mound for Fannin, allowing 9 hits and one run over 6 and 2/3rds innings while striking out one and allowing zero walks. Gavin Davis collected the final out of the game for Fannin and earned the save.

Gaige Foster and Elijah Weaver led Fannin with 2 hits a piece, while Stroemer led both teams with 3 RBIs.

Durden had some good stuff on the mound for Haralson as he struck out 10 Fannin batters, but the early double from Stroemer was the difference maker as Durden earned the loss on the evening. Haralson will travel to Mount Paran on Thursday for their first round playoff game.
